1. Lunar Calendar

The lunar calendar is our country’s traditional calendar, and it also has names such as the lunar calendar, the Chinese calendar, the summer calendar, the Chinese calendar, and the Chinese calendar. The lunar calendar is not a pure lunar calendar, but a lunisolar calendar. The changing cycle of the moon phase, that is, the synodic month, is the length of the month, and the "twenty-four solar terms" of the stem and branch calendar are added. The solar return year is the length of the year. By setting the leap month To make the average calendar year fit with the tropical year. The lunar calendar is a calendar based on the lunar calendar (Xia calendar) and integrating elements of the solar calendar. Therefore, our country's lunar calendar should not be called a lunar calendar in a strict sense, but a luni-solar calendar.

The lunar calendar is a luni-solar calendar: its years are divided into ordinary years and leap years. There are twelve months in an ordinary year and thirteen months in a leap year. The month is divided into a big month and a small month. The big month has thirty days and the small month has twenty-nine days. The average calendar month is equal to one synodic month. Which month of the year is larger and which month is smaller is determined by calculation.

The lunar calendar is a calendar that takes into account the relationship between the sun, the moon and the earth. Unlike the Gregorian calendar year, which is fixed at 365 or 366 days, the lunar calendar year sometimes differs by one month from the solar calendar year. In order to coordinate the number of days between the lunar calendar year and the solar calendar year, the "leap method" is used. Adjust the total number of days in the lunar calendar to the total number of days in the solar year.

3. Gregorian Calendar

The solar calendar, also known as the solar calendar, is a calendar based on the movement cycle of the earth revolving around the sun. The calendar year of the solar calendar is approximately equal to the tropical year, with 12 months in a year.
